Output 807d761204039bee8ace946b83feaff7dc40a39cf4316bd963517fccbb24b45b:0

value
3380890
script pubkey
OP_0 OP_PUSHBYTES_20 c40c709f6c7896286d4c130ee4345df0ad3d74f7
address
bc1qcsx8p8mv0ztzsm2vzv8wgdza7zkn6a8hzrf3z8
transaction
807d761204039bee8ace946b83feaff7dc40a39cf4316bd963517fccbb24b45b